I created a document/flyer that I now desire to add bullets/symbols at the beginning of each important point. Some of these "points" have 2 or 3 lines. When I insert the symbol at the beginning of the first line, the lines below are lining up under the symbol as opposed to under the indented text, where I would like them.

Set a hanging indent of 0.5cm for the style/paragraph format of the paragraphs in question and make sure all the paragraphs have two spaces between the bullet and the text and not one as is the case with some of them. Better still set a suitable tab between them and match the hanging indent to the tab.
